Is Jake lever a key defender?
Almost all would say he is an intercept defender. Yet he is an inch taller than our guys.

The game is less about one on one contests  now and more about team defence.
Agree....with Melbourne its actually Petty who does all the monkey work defense and Lever and May who do the intercept up the ground stuff  It is more and more about covering your teammates man while he is covering someone elses man while the intercept defenders are doing their thing and it requires team defense and understanding the game tactically.
I see Weitering and Young as true KP defenders and Marchbank/McGovern as the intercept defenders.....you wouldnt be expecting the latter two to be picking up Lynch, Dixon, Hawkins etc who I would describe as Power KP Forwards given their size and strength.
The extra cm and kegs do make a big difference....
